#1beb58 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1beb58 is composed of 10.6% red, 92.2%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 62.6%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 137.6 degrees, a saturation of 83.9% and a lightness of 51.4%. #1beb58 color hex could be obtained by blending #36ffb0 with #00d700. Closest websafe color is: #33ff66.

#1beb58 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1beb58 has RGB values of R:27, G:235,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0, Y:0.63,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 1829720.
